Identification of Changes in Cancer-related Fatigue and Physical Activity and Their Association in Patients With Inoperable Lung Cancer: a Longitudinal Observational Study

The goal of this observational study is to learn how fatigue changes during lung cancer treatment and how it relates to physical activity levels in adults with locally advanced, inoperable, or metastatic lung cancer who are starting chemotherapy and/or immunotherapy.
